Ticket: Partner SFTP drop vault locked — Merrowfield feed stalled

The credentials vault for the Merrowfield partner SFTP drop auto-locked after three failed rotation attempts on Tuesday. Inbound price files are queuing on the edge host and will age out in 72 hours. Ops confirmed the vault itself is healthy; it just needs a manual unseal before the next pull window. Whoever picks this up should unseal it using the recovery passphrase below.

vault phrase of tajeg-tageg = pelix-druix-holius-briael-zorwyn-frawyn-fraox-norok-drueth-aldiel

### FAQ: Why does Nimbix sometimes fail DNS resolution?

New folks ask this a lot. The Nimbix staging cluster uses a local resolver that occasionally drops entries when the upstream zone reloads, so lookups for internal services fail for a few seconds. It's flaky, not broken. If it persists past a minute, restart the resolver pod via the recovery console. The console will ask you to confirm with the recovery passphrase shown below.

strongbox words: zorox-holix

Subject: DR drill — InvoiceForge renderer, Thursday

Welcome aboard. Thursday's drill simulates total loss of the InvoiceForge PDF rendering cluster in the Dunmere region. Your role: restore the renderer from the cold snapshot, verify font embedding, and confirm a test invoice renders identically to the golden copy. You'll need access to the sealed restore account, which stays dormant outside drills. Do not reset it; doing so invalidates the escrow. The account's recovery passphrase is recorded below.

vault phrase of kajop-kaweg = sorix-istys-noviel